DJI orders Texas Instruments automotive chips

Chinese consumer drone and vehicle intelligence firm Shenzhen Dji Sciences and Technologies has begun ordering millions of chips from US semiconductor firm Texas Instruments (TI) for its upcoming intelligent driving system for automaker clients, Kallanish learns.  According to an anonymous source from the Chinese vehicle technology industry, DJI is mainly ordering TI's TDA4 chips.  Through highly integrated chip design, the TDA4 chip integrates vari…
